Why Companies Need More Spanish Call Center Agents

More companies are expanding their customer service reach by hiring Spanish-speaking staff. Several factors explain why this need continues to rise.

1. Large Spanish-Speaking Population

The Hispanic population in the U.S. continues to grow and now represents over 18% of the total U.S. population. Many prefer customer support in their native language, which has pushed businesses to open more Spanish call center agent jobs.

2. Global Market Expansion

Companies expanding into Latin America need to offer customer support in Spanish to meet regional expectations. Without localized support, businesses risk losing customers.

3. Rising Service Expectations

Customers expect fast, clear answers. When there’s a language gap, response times increase and satisfaction drops. Bilingual agents help solve issues quickly and efficiently.

4. Multilingual Customer Service Is Now Standard

Businesses that offer multilingual customer service can better meet the needs of global clients. Spanish is often the first language added due to its wide use.

5. Lower Error Rates and Better Resolution

Clear communication helps reduce mistakes. Spanish-speaking agents minimize misunderstandings and improve first-call resolution.

Roles in Demand Within Spanish Call Center Operations

There are several roles that companies commonly seek when building or expanding their Spanish-language support teams.

1. Customer Support Representatives

These agents handle general inquiries, product questions, and basic troubleshooting—all in Spanish.

2. Technical Support Agents

Tech companies often seek Spanish-speaking tech support to help customers resolve hardware or software issues.

3. Billing and Collections Specialists

Finance and telecom firms hire bilingual agents for account management, billing questions, and collections.

4. Sales Support and Lead Generation

Companies looking to sell products in Spanish-speaking regions need bilingual reps for lead qualification and outreach.

5. Retention Specialists

Agents trained to handle customer complaints and retain clients are critical for long-term satisfaction.
